First off, let's understand what abrasion resistance means. In simple terms, it's the ability of a material to withstand wear and tear caused by friction when it comes into contact with another surface. For Aluminium Alloy Pipe, abrasion resistance is a crucial property, especially in industries where the pipes are used in harsh environments.

Aluminium alloy pipes have a unique combination of properties that contribute to their abrasion resistance. Aluminium itself has a relatively low density, which makes the pipes lightweight and easy to handle. But it's the alloying elements that really boost the abrasion - resistant capabilities. Elements like magnesium, silicon, and copper are commonly added to aluminium to form alloys. These alloying elements create a stronger and more durable structure at the microscopic level.

Magnesium, for example, can increase the strength of the aluminium alloy. When a pipe is made from an aluminium - magnesium alloy, it becomes more resistant to scratches and abrasions. Silicon also plays a vital role. It forms hard silicon particles within the alloy matrix. These particles act as a sort of armor, protecting the pipe surface from being worn away by rough objects or abrasive materials.

Now, let's talk about the factors that can affect the abrasion resistance of Aluminium Alloy Pipe. One of the main factors is the surface finish. A smooth surface finish reduces the contact area between the pipe and the abrasive material, which in turn decreases the amount of friction and wear. Compared to other types of pipes, Aluminium Alloy Pipes have some distinct advantages in terms of abrasion resistance. For instance, when compared to steel pipes, aluminium alloy pipes are lighter and less prone to rust. Rust can weaken the structure of a steel pipe and make it more susceptible to abrasion. And unlike plastic pipes, Aluminium Alloy Pipes can handle higher temperatures and pressures without deforming, which is essential in many industrial applications.
